Hello, my name is canon printer error XXXXX XXXXX I am here to assist you.If your printer is working fine with other pdf files it may be something in that one that the printer wont recognize or the file is corrupt in some way. You can try switching to preview view and then print from there and see if that works(mac preview the pdf file).Its an issue with adobe for mac that they havent quite worked out yet(if ever, been there for like 10 years).You can also try removing your printer from the printers menu and then running an update from the apple menu. Then readd the printer again. That sometimes works with this error but most of the time not. Also try resetting your print system on the mac, that may help.Resetting the printing system in OS X LionTo use the Reset Printing System function in Lion, follow these steps: Choose System Preferences from the Apple menu. Choose Print & Scan from the View menu. Hold down the Option key while clicking the "-" (Remove printer) button. If no printers are currently added, hold down th

After I unboxed it, I followed the steps in the maual, but at boot-up the MFP stopped at Error Code 5030. I have turned the power off and reconnected the plug several times but the same message is coming up. I have not found error codes specifically under MG8220, but for all series (61xx, 62xx, 81xx) they are the same. According to my research this code means - "Scanner home position error; Scanner error; Flatbed motor error; Scanner light source not turned on; Scanner electric circuit error."
